Frequently asked questions

Can I merge clips recorded on different phones?

Yes. Clips with different resolutions, aspect ratios, frame rates or rotations are fitted into one output frame and resampled to one frame rate when normalization is required.

Can I merge without any effect?

Yes. Hard cut is the default. Compatible streams can join without re-encoding; audio timing or other edits may require only the affected tracks to be normalized. Transitions are optional per cut.

In what order are the clips joined?

In the order shown on the clip rail. Drag a clip or use its left and right arrow buttons to reorder it.

Is the audio from every clip kept?

Yes when the browser can read the source audio. Compatible hard-cut projects copy it; normalized projects rebuild one timeline, respect per-clip mute, and crossfade audio under transitions.

How long can the merged video be?

There is no single reliable browser-wide limit. Processing uses device memory and local temporary storage, so the practical ceiling depends on the clips, browser, device and output settings.

Advanced compatibility checks
  1. Before processing, note the source container, video and audio codecs when known, duration, dimensions, frame rate, orientation, audio-track count, and intended destination. Also record the exact cut, crop, timing, visual correction, or extraction you expect. These observations create a baseline for comparing the export instead of relying on memory.
  2. Run a short representative sample first and change one setting at a time. Browser codec support, available memory, hardware acceleration, and input structure can affect which processing path is available. A successful preview for one sample shows only that observed case; it does not establish compatibility for every file with the same extension.
  3. Inspect the preview around the portions most likely to expose defects: the beginning and final frame, cut boundaries, rapid motion, fine text, faces, object edges, gradients, orientation changes, and any section where sound should align with a visible event. For model-assisted tools, look for missed regions, unstable masks, invented detail, or frame-to-frame drift.
  4. Open the downloaded file in a separate current player rather than reviewing only the in-page preview. Confirm that it starts and ends where expected, plays through without an unexpected stall, and has the intended duration, dimensions, orientation, frame rate, audio presence, and synchronization. Check the file again in the platform or editor that will consume it.
  5. Compare the exported clip with the untouched source at the same viewing scale and, when useful, matched playback volume. Look for unexpected crops, padding, stretch, softness, banding, halos, color shifts, temporal jumps, repeated or missing frames, and changes in file size or codec that matter to the destination. Decide whether any difference is acceptable for the stated task.
  6. If the result is missing, fails to play, or differs from the preview, first confirm that the source opens independently. Reload the page, retry with a small controlled sample, reset optional controls, and preserve the exact on-page message. Testing one controlled change at a time makes browser, input, setting, and destination failures distinguishable.
  7. Record the Merge Videos URL, relevant settings, browser and device, date, source identity, output filename, and observed checks. Keep before-and-after files when the result matters. This record supports a reproducible comparison later and avoids treating a changed input, capability, or destination requirement as the same run.
